Glenn Jones said...

Hi! Thanks for stopping by my blog!

I have found the best approach for a belt is the Nathan 4 (http://www.nathansports.com/our_products/hydration_nutrition/speed_4.html). The bottles slide in nicely and don't jiggle. With all 4 bottles full, you get 40 oz of liquid - enough for a decent long run. Also, there is a key pocket on the front, and a larger pocket on the back of the belt. I can carry a Clif Bar, four gels, and a ultracompact camera. If you have a running store nearby, check it out.

The other thing I know people swear by are shorts by RaceReady (http://www.raceready.com). The pockets are sewn into the shorts. Some love them. Some hate them. Look for them the next time you're at a race. Someone will be wearing them.

As far as Gus, I don't have stomach issues, but I think some of the Gus are pretty putrid. I like only the Espresso Love and Vanilla Bean. Make sure you take water to wash it down!

I've heard others swear by the gummi lifesavers. About the same number of calories as Gus. Better tasting. No sodium though, which ends up being an issue if you are prone to cramping.
